Third data release of the Hyper Suprime-Cam Subaru Strategic Program
Ono, Yoshiaki; Ouchi, Masami; Harikane, Yuichi +64 more
This paper presents the third data release of the Hyper Suprime-Cam Subaru Strategic Program (HSC-SSP), a wide-field multi-band imaging survey with the Subaru 8.2 m telescope. X-ray selected narrow-line active galactic nuclei in the COSMOS field: Nature of optically dull active galactic nuclei
Murayama, Takashi; Fitriana, Itsna K.
X-ray emission detection in a galaxy is one of the efficient tools for selecting active galactic nuclei (AGNs). However, many X-ray-selected AGNs are not easily selected as AGNs by their optical emission.
